What is a Physiatrist?
A physiatrist is a medical doctor who specializes in physical medicine and rehab. They concentrate on diagnosing, treating, and managing a variety of conditions that affect movement and quality of life, especially those resulting from injury, health problem, or disability. Their objective is to assist patients recuperate function, reconstruct strength, and enhance lifestyle through non-surgical techniques.
Typical Conditions Treated by Physiatrists
Physiatrists address a broad variety of conditions, consisting of however not restricted to:

Physiatrists play a vital role in bring back function and enhancing quality of life. Reasons to seek advice from a physiatrist might include:
- Non-surgical intervention choices
- Customized rehab programs
- Coordination of care with other medical experts
- Emphasis on holistic treatment including physical, emotional, and social elements
How to Find a Physiatrist Near You
When looking for a physiatrist, numerous elements must be thought about:
- Location: Proximity is essential for regular appointments. Use online directories to filter by place.
- Insurance coverage: Check if the physiatrist is covered under your health insurance coverage plan.
- Specialty: Some physiatrists may specialize in various areas, such as sports medicine, pediatrics, or discomfort management.
- Track record and Reviews: Online reviews and testimonials can supply insight into patient experiences.
- Services Offered: Some clinics might offer thorough rehab programs, while others focus on particular treatments.

An initial assessment with a physiatrist usually includes:
- Medical History Review: Discussing existing symptoms, previous medical concerns, and previous treatments.
- Health examination: An assessment of the affected areas consisting of mobility, strength, and series of movement.
- Diagnostic Tests: May include imaging studies or other diagnostic tools to identify the very best treatment technique.
- Treatment Plan: Development of an individualized strategy that may include physical treatment, medications, and other interventions.
Advantages of Seeing a Physiatrist
There are numerous benefits when dealing with a physiatrist, including:
- Diversified Treatment Options: Access to various treatments like physical therapy, occupational therapy, or interventional pain management.
- Multi-disciplinary Approach: Coordination with other professionals such as orthopedic surgeons, neurologists, and therapists ensures thorough care.
- Focus on Functionality: Focuses on enhancing everyday activities, occupational efficiency, and total physical health.
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)
Q1: How do I know if I should see a physiatrist?
A: If you are experiencing persistent discomfort, movement problems, or have actually suffered an injury that affects your every day life, seeking advice from a physiatrist can be helpful.
Q2: What is the difference in between a physiatrist and a physiotherapist?
A: A physiatrist is a medical doctor who can detect medical conditions and offer comprehensive healthcare, while a physical therapist concentrates on treatment through exercises and physical rehabilitation.
Q3: Will I need a recommendation to see a physiatrist?
A: It depends upon your insurance strategy. Some require a referral from your main care doctor, while others might permit you to see a specialist straight.
Q4: What types of treatments will a physiatrist supply?
A: Treatments may range from injections and medications to supervised physical treatment and assistive devices.
Q5: How long will treatment take?
A: The period differs commonly depending on the condition, the treatment plan, and specific patient progress. Some may improve in weeks, while others may require months of rehab.
